Q: Is 563,176,506 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 563,176,506 is a composite number.

Why is 563,176,506 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 563,176,506 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 5,237 10,474 15,711 17,923 31,422 35,846 53,769 107,538 93,862,751 187,725,502 281,588,253 and 563,176,506, with no remainder.

Since 563,176,506 cannot be divided by just 1 and 563,176,506, it is a composite number.
